Conan returns to late night on TBS

Iconic poster for Conan's recent comedy tour.

Ted Turner is probably doing a Mexican hat dance right now. Conan O’Brien will return to late night on basic-cable superstation TBS in November. Yes, the same TBS that brought you Frank Caliendo and and a slew of Tyler Perry TV projects.

Not long after Jay Leno recouped his precious Tonight Show timeslot, the announcement is kind of ironic in part because he will be taking George Lopez’ timeslot. But it seems that Lopez was one of the catalysts for the deal so no acrimony there. Fans looking for a little CoCo fix have been trying to get it anyway they can, either with his comedy tour or even driving to work.

R.I.P ’24′

Kiefer Sutherland as Jack Bauer in Fox's "24"

Jack Bauer can finally catch his breath (or can he?). Fox is ending the hit TV show “24″ after this season but a film version is said to be in the pipeline. It appears that the terrorists have won. Here’s the link:

The show, which was innovative originally for being told in real-time (sorta), killing off fan-favorite characters even before Lost did and finally for the growing argument as to its use of torture (Bauer is all for it), is the second longest-running espionage thriller TV show right behind The Avengers.
